How to Put a Braided Fishing Line on a Reel

Braided fishing line offers many advantages over traditional monofilament lines, including high strength, minimal stretch, resistance to abrasion and lack of "line memory." However, these characteristics also mean that using braided line can be different from fishing with monofilament.

How to Put a Sinker on the Line When Fishing

According to Bass Pro Shops, sinkers are one of the most important elements of your fishing tackle. The Fish Resource website explains that using a sinker of the right style and weight can enhance your cast and allow you to anchor, troll, drift and present your bait or lure more effectively.

When to Fish for Salmon in Michigan?

Salmon fishing has been a major part of the sport fishing industry in Michigan since the introduction of several salmon species into the Great Lakes system in the 1960s to control alewife populations.
